普通网友 2025-06-27 08:40 采纳率: 98.5%
浏览 45
已采纳

问题:如何在Altium Designer中快速调整PCB元器件方向?

在使用Altium Designer进行PCB设计时,如何快速调整元器件方向是设计师常遇到的问题。手动旋转元件不仅效率低,还容易影响布局精度。许多用户不清楚如何通过快捷键或工具实现高效调整,导致设计流程变慢。本文将介绍几种实用的方法,包括使用空格键、Shift+空格组合、属性面板设置以及对齐与排列工具,帮助你大幅提升布局效率。掌握这些技巧后,你将能在实际项目中更加灵活地控制元器件方向,提升整体设计质量。
  • 写回答

1条回答 默认 最新

  • 小小浏 2025-10-21 22:39
    关注

    Altium Designer中快速调整元器件方向的高效技巧

    一、基础操作:使用空格键快速旋转元件

    在Altium Designer中,最常用且高效的元器件旋转方式是使用键盘上的空格键。当你选中一个元件后,按下空格键可以以90度为步长顺时针旋转该元件。

    • 适用于单个元件的快速布局调整
    • 节省鼠标点击操作时间
    • 适合初学者快速上手

    二、进阶技巧:Shift + 空格组合实现逆时针旋转

    除了顺时针旋转外,设计师有时需要进行更精确的方向控制。Shift + 空格键组合可以在不切换工具的情况下实现逆时针旋转。

    操作功能描述
    空格键顺时针旋转90度
    Shift + 空格逆时针旋转90度

    三、精准设置:通过属性面板手动输入角度

    对于某些特殊布局需求(如倾斜45度放置LED),可以使用属性面板(Properties Panel)来精确设定元件的旋转角度。

    1. 选中目标元件
    2. 打开右侧属性面板
    3. 在Rotation字段中输入所需角度(如45°)
    4. 回车确认

    此方法适用于高精度设计场景,如射频电路或结构配合要求严格的项目。

    四、批量处理:对齐与排列工具的应用

    当需要调整多个元件的方向并保持整齐排列时,Altium Designer提供了强大的对齐与排列工具。

    
    // 示例:将多个电阻按相同方向排列
    1. 按住Shift选择多个元件
    2. 右键菜单选择Align → Align Objects
    3. 在弹出窗口中选择对齐方式(Top, Bottom, Left, Right)
      

    五、流程优化:结合快捷键与工具提升效率

    熟练掌握以下工作流可以显著提升布板效率:

    graph TD A[选择元件] --> B{是否单个元件?} B -- 是 --> C[使用空格键/Shift+空格旋转] B -- 否 --> D[使用属性面板统一设置角度] C --> E[使用对齐工具排列] D --> E

    六、常见问题分析与解决建议

    以下是用户在实际操作中常遇到的问题及解决方案:

    问题现象可能原因解决方法
    旋转后元件位置偏移未锁定原点使用“Edit → Set Origin”重新定义旋转中心
    批量旋转失败未正确选择多个对象使用框选或Shift多选,并检查是否被锁定
    旋转角度不一致手动输入误差使用属性面板统一设置Rotation值

    七、高级应用:脚本化与自定义命令

    对于资深用户,可以通过编写Altium脚本(如使用DelphiScript或JavaScript)实现自动化旋转任务。

    
    procedure RotateSelectedComponents(angle: Integer);
    var
      i: Integer;
    begin
      for i := 0 to PCBGroup.Count - 1 do
      begin
        if PCBGroup.Item(i).IsKindOf('Component') then
        begin
          PCBGroup.Item(i).Rotation := angle;
        end;
      end;
    end;
      
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 6月27日